Frontier Gal (1945)

December 14, 1945 (US) Romance, Western • 92m

Overview

Johnny Hart is on the run from the law after killing one of the men who shot his partner. He passes through a town and stops at a saloon owned by singer Lorena Dumont. The two seem a good, albeit tempestuous match, although Johnny has no plans to marry -- Lorena has other ideas and a shotgun wedding ensues.

Frontier Gal (AKA: The Bride Wasn't Willing) is directed by Charles Lamont and written by Michael Fessier and Ernest Pagano. It stars Rod Cameron, Yvonne De Carlo, Andy Devine, Fuzzy Knight, Sheldon Leonard, Andrew Tombes and Clara Blandwick. Music is by Frank Skinner and Technicolor photography is shared by Charles Boyle and George Robinson.
